6. Hold A PPV Or WWE Network Special In England

Part of what makes a show great is a hot crowd. Whenever WWE goes to England for Raw & Smackdown tapings twice per year the result is always one of the best audiences of the year. They make noise when they're supposed to, they chant random things when they shouldn't and they generally have a great time. They've also had an influence on the post WrestleMania Raw episode too. Since WWE mentioned recently that they're going to make WWE Network available in England like this August or September, they should celebrate it by holding a three hour event in an arena around that time. I know people in England want an outdoor show, but nothing wrong with an arena. Do it on a Saturday night in England 8pm local time so that it airs in the Eastern US at 3pm and can be replayed all weekend. They need more content on WWE Network. They also need to do a special show in England aside from four TV shows in a year. Call it the British Invasion or something like that. Have something major happen. There's nothing wrong with thinking outside the box or creating major shows in markets that deserve them.
